Which of the following is a characteristic sign of hyperthyroidism?
Cold intolerance
Fatigue and lethargy
Tremors and nervousness
Weight gain
The Correct Answer is C
A. Cold intolerance: Incorrect. Cold intolerance is associated with hypothyroidism, not hyperthyroidism.
B. Fatigue and lethargy: Symptoms typically seen in hypothyroidism.
C. Tremors and nervousness Correct Answer. Hyperthyroidism often presents with symptoms such as tremors (especially in the hands) and nervousness due to increased sympathetic activity. Increased metabolism and sympathetic nervous system activity lead to these symptoms.
D. Weight gain: Typically seen in hypothyroidism due to slowed metabolism.
